Dwayne Johnson seems ready as ever to begin his journey into a new era. The WrestleMania star is making sure he wants to push himself harder than ever before to “make films that matter,” which has brought him to the role of the MMA legend, Mark Kerr.
The wrestler turned actor, is set to be seen in the upcoming Bennie Safdie directed, ‘The Smashing Machine’ which will be produced and financed by the arthouse indie studio/distributor, A24, one of the leading production studios in the biz right now, with major hits like, “Moonlight” (2016), “Everything Everywhere All At Once” (2022) which went on to win Academy awards for best picture, and highly acclaimed arcane cinemas, “The Lighthouse” (2019), “Hereditary” (2018), and more.

‘The Rock’ looks almost unrecognizable in the teaser that A24 posted on social media. It is something that has never been seen before from Johnson. Dwayne sits at a corner of a boxing ring being tended to, shed of his trademark tattoos he also appears to have a thick brush of hair, sporting some facial prosthetics.
Johnson will be playing the lead in Safdie’s first solo directorial venture, as the two-time UFC Heavyweight Tournament Champion and World Vale Tudo Championship tournament winner, Mark Kerr. The MMA luminary who struggled with addiction and his marriage, won over two dozen MMA titles, during the course of his career.
Safdie, who will be serving as the director and scriptwriter for the feature, has made a mark as a filmmaker at the side of his brother, Josh Safdie, creating the famed crime/thriller films, ‘Good Time’ (2017) and ‘Uncut Gems’ (2019). He also appeared in a handful of films this year as an actor, most notably as Edward Teller in the Christopher Nolan-directed, ‘Oppenheimer.’
Emily Blunt will be starring alongside Johnson in the drama, and will be portraying Kerr’s wife, Dawn Staples. She also worked beside the ‘Jumanji’ actor in the 2021 adventure, ‘Jungle Cruise.’
As of yet, A24 has not announced a released date for “The Smashing Machine.”
